    I just spoke with Toyota via 1-800-331-4331, and was informed that they switched companies to provide this service, and that the ONLY option to get Remote Connect is to buy one of the bundled services starting at $15/month, which is absurd being that Carplay and Android Auto already provide all of the dumb features they are trying to force on us. "Music Lovers" is also pointless for someone that uses Spotify, and not Apple or Amazon. She said this change just happened 2 weeks ago.

    the problem is the ROI of drone vs toyota.

    the drone now for me after i checked was $550 installed + $360 for 5yr gps plan = $910

    toyota at $15 month would take 60 months to break even with the drone install + service.

    so then it becomes an issue of if you intend to keep your toyota longer than 60 months or trade in before that.
